Rooney hits back at TV commentators

05:44 am on 26 November 2013

Manchester United football star Wayne Rooney has hit out at two television commentators for saying he deserved to be sent off during his side's 2-2 draw at Cardiff City.

Sky Sports commentator Martin Tyler and pundit Graeme Souness, the former Liverpool manager, said Rooney was fortunate not to be shown a red card for kicking Jordon Mutch during the early stages of the Premier League game on Monday.

Rooney was instead shown a yellow card by referee Neil Swarbrick and went on to score the opening goal for United and set up their second goal, which was scored by Patrice Evra.

Rooney, who deliberately referred to Souness as "Sourness", says more attention should have been paid to an incident in the second half in which Cardiff midfielder Gary Medel appeared to slap United's Marouane Fellaini.
